diff --git a/src/Compute/Compute/ChangeLog.md b/src/Compute/Compute/ChangeLog.md index 8e58b2dfaf9d..71a7dd712473 100644 --- a/src/Compute/Compute/ChangeLog.md +++ b/src/Compute/Compute/ChangeLog.md @@ -23,6 +23,7 @@ * Added `SkuProfileVmSize` and `SkuProfileAllocationStrategy` parameters to `New-AzVmss`, `New-AzVmssConfig`, and `Update-AzVmss` cmdlets for VMSS Instance Mix operations. * Added a new optional parameter `-GenerateSshKey-type` to the `New-AzVM` cmdlet, allowing users to specify the type of SSH key to generate (Ed25519 or RSA). * Added `EnableResilientVMCreate` and `EnableResilientVMDelete` parameters to `Update-AzVmss` and `New-AzVmssConfig` cmdlets for enhanced VM resilience options. +* Added `IsVMInStandByPool` property to `PSVirtualMachineInstanceView` object. [#25736] ## Version 8.3.0 * Fixed secrets exposure in example documentation. diff --git a/src/Compute/Compute/Generated/Models/PSVirtualMachineInstanceView.cs b/src/Compute/Compute/Generated/Models/PSVirtualMachineInstanceView.cs index 4b6c9308e757..310f6017a4c1 100644 --- a/src/Compute/Compute/Generated/Models/PSVirtualMachineInstanceView.cs +++ b/src/Compute/Compute/Generated/Models/PSVirtualMachineInstanceView.cs @@ -43,6 +43,7 @@ public partial class PSVirtualMachineInstanceView public IList Statuses { get; set; } public VirtualMachinePatchStatus PatchStatus { get; set; } public VirtualMachineHealthStatus VmHealth { get; set; } + public bool? IsVMInStandbyPool { get; set; } } } diff --git a/src/Compute/Compute/Models/PSVirtualMachineInstanceView.cs b/src/Compute/Compute/Models/PSVirtualMachineInstanceView.cs index 89f18869f035..5a7cf7c9d369 100644 --- a/src/Compute/Compute/Models/PSVirtualMachineInstanceView.cs +++ b/src/Compute/Compute/Models/PSVirtualMachineInstanceView.cs @@ -27,6 +27,7 @@ public class PSVirtualMachineInstanceView public string OsVersion { get; set; } public string HyperVGeneration { get; set; } public string AssignedHost {get; set; } + public bool? IsVMInStandbyPool { get; set; } public BootDiagnosticsInstanceView BootDiagnostics { get; set; } @@ -75,7 +76,8 @@ public static PSVirtualMachineInstanceView ToPSVirtualMachineInstanceView( HyperVGeneration = virtualMachineInstanceView.HyperVGeneration, PatchStatus = virtualMachineInstanceView.PatchStatus, VMHealth = virtualMachineInstanceView.VmHealth, - AssignedHost = virtualMachineInstanceView.AssignedHost + AssignedHost = virtualMachineInstanceView.AssignedHost, + IsVMInStandbyPool = virtualMachineInstanceView.IsVMInStandbyPool }; return result;